Tract 1 Description: 80+/- Acres in the S/2 of the NW/4 of 9-28-7 in Kingman Co., Ks. Located just outside of Kingman this tract is a great build site with tons of potential. There is currently 12+/- acres in tillable production with the remainder in native grasses. This tract also has a pond, 40x42 metal building with a lean-to, 30x30 shed, and several other livestock buildings. Majority of the property is fenced. Great location to build and get out of town, or utilize for cattle grazing. Do not overlook this farm from the hunting stand point as there is deer sign all over it, and surrounded by good hunting properties.

Tract 2 Description: 211+/- Acres in S09-T28-R07W. This tract features year-round live water from Hunter Creek running through 3/4 mile of heavy timbered creek bottom, a 1.5 acre pond located on the south end of the property, 14+/- tillable acres for production or food plots, and a planted walnut grove on the south end of the farm. With mature timber and an abundance of ideal habitat, this property possesses exceptional deer, waterfowl, quail, and turkey hunting. With the Ninnescah River just 1/2 mile away to the north, the waterfowl hunting is outstanding. There is access located at the north end of the property as well as power. This would also be a prime location to build your dream home! 

Gas Production: There is currently an active gas well on the property producing roughly $300-$400 per month. The mineral rights will transfer.
